Types of BMW Keys
[BMW keys](https://www.aprilburton.top/automotive/unlocking-the-possibilities-your-guide-to-bmw-spare-keys/) have actually evolved considerably over the years. Comprehending the kind of key your lorry uses is critical for efficient replacement. Here's a breakdown of the different types of keys:
Key TypeDescriptionPopular ModelsBasic KeyA basic metal key without electronic parts; most typical in older designs.BMW 3 Series (E30, E36)Transponder KeyA key embedded with a chip that interacts with the automobile's ignition system for added security.BMW 3 Series (E90, E92)Smart KeyA key that allows keyless entry and ignition; equipped with innovative functions like remote start and trunk release.BMW 7 Series (G11, G12), X5 (F15)Key FobA remote control that usually consists of features like locking/unlocking doors and beginning the engine without placing a key.BMW 5 Series (F10), X3 (F25)Steps to Replace a BMW Key
When it concerns replacing a BMW key, there are numerous steps included. Below is a basic standard that will assist you browse the procedure.
1. Identify the Type of Key Required
Identifying the best type of key is important. Refer to the table above to see what type your automobile needs.
2. Collect Necessary Documentation
You will need to provide evidence of ownership. Required files may consist of:
Vehicle title or registrationValid image IDVehicle recognition number (VIN)3. Contact a BMW Dealership or Certified Locksmith
While some might choose independent locksmiths to conserve money, it's essential to consider that not all locksmiths can set BMW keys. It is typically advised to go through main BMW dealerships for the very best outcomes.
4. Key Order and Programming
Once you've selected your supplier, they will purchase the new key. Key programming can take anywhere from 15 minutes to a couple of hours, depending upon the make and model.
5. Evaluating the New Key
Once you have your new key, ensure it works correctly with both the ignition and remote features. Check all functionalities to confirm that whatever is working as expected.
Cost of BMW Key Replacement
The cost of replacing a BMW key can differ widely based on numerous factors such as the design, key type, and where you choose to get the key from. Below is an approximated cost breakdown:
Key TypeTypical CostNotesStandard Key₤ 50 - ₤ 150Often offered at locksmith professionalsTransponder Key₤ 100 - ₤ 300Requires programmingSmart Key₤ 200 - ₤ 600Most pricey due to sophisticated innovationKey Fob₤ 250 - ₤ 700Prices differ based on featuresAdditional Costs to ConsiderProgramming Fees: Some providers charge extra for programming the key.Towing Fees: If your automobile is not available, you may incur towing costs.Shipping Fees: If ordering a key from a dealer, there may be delivering expenses involved.Often Asked Questions (FAQ)1. How long does it require to replace a BMW key?
The time it takes can differ depending on whether you are getting a key from a dealership or a locksmith. Generally, it can take anywhere from 30 minutes to a few hours.
2. Can I replace my BMW key myself?
No, due to the programming and chip requirements, replacing a BMW key usually requires professional services.
3. What should I do if I lose my only BMW key?
If you lose your only key, you will need to get in touch with a BMW car dealership or a certified locksmith for assistance. They may require evidence of ownership.
4. Are there any options to standard keys?
Yes, numerous newer BMW designs come with digital key alternatives that allow you to utilize your smartphone to unlock and begin your vehicle.
5. What if my key isn't working after replacement?
If your new key isn't working, ensure that it has been properly set. If all else stops working, go back to the dealership or locksmith for troubleshooting.
